E-Tickets and QR Code Check-In

LatePoint Pro supports E-Tickets with QR codes for Event Registrations. You can use them to scan attendees at the event or check them in manually.

Enable E-Tickets

Go to LatePoint > Settings > General > Events , and Enable Enable E-Tickets – QR Code.

Once enabled, LatePoint automatically generates a unique ticket and QR code when an event registration is created.

Individual and Group Tickets

LatePoint creates one individual ticket for each attendee.

For example, a registration for 3 tickets creates:

  • Ticket 1 of 3
  • Ticket 2 of 3
  • Ticket 3 of 3
  • Group Ticket

A registration for 1 ticket creates only one individual ticket.

Each ticket has its own unique ticket code, QR code, public ticket page, and downloadable PDF.

If Ticket Types are enabled, the ticket type is included in the label, for example VIP — Ticket 1 of 3.

Check-In Page

Go to LatePoint > Events > Tickets

Select an event to view its tickets.

From this page, you can:

  • Search for a ticket using its ticket code.
  • View ticket and attendee details.
  • View or download a ticket.
  • Manually check in a ticket.
  • Scan an E-Ticket using the Scan E-Ticket button.

Scanning E-Tickets

Click Scan E-Ticket to open the scanner.

You can:

  • Scan the QR code using your device’s camera.
  • Enter the ticket code manually if scanning is not possible.

After validation, LatePoint displays the ticket and attendee details along with the check-in result.

Possible results include:

  • Valid: The ticket was successfully checked in.
  • Partially Checked In: Some tickets in a Group Ticket have been checked in.
  • All Checked In: All tickets in the group have already been checked in.
  • Already Checked In: The ticket has already been checked in for that date.
  • Not Found: The ticket code is invalid.
  • Cancelled / Event Cancelled: The registration or event has been cancelled.
  • Void: The ticket has been voided.
  • Not Valid Today: The ticket is being used outside its valid event date.

Group Ticket Check-In

Scanning a Group Ticket checks in all individual tickets in that registration that have not already been checked in.

For example, if 1 of 3 attendees has already checked in individually, scanning the Group Ticket will check in the remaining 2 attendees.

Multi-Day Events

For multi-day events, a ticket can be checked in once on each valid event date.

For example, for an event running from September 15–17, the same ticket can be checked in once on each of those three dates.

Scanning the same ticket again on the same date returns Already Checked In.

Manual Check-In

QR code scanning is optional. You can manually check in attendees from: LatePoint > Events > Tickets

Each ticket has a Check In action.

This is useful when you are working from a printed attendee list or cannot scan the QR code.
